The concept of planned obsolescence emerged between 1920 and 1930 with the intention of creating a new market model, which aimed to manufacture products with limited durability premeditated way forcing consumers to buy new products so fast and without a real need. Lamps and fight Benito Walls respond to a new business concept, based on developing products that do not expire, like those Frigidaire refrigerators or washing machines Westinghouse that lasted a lifetime. A business philosophy more in line with our times, thanks to the marketing of products that are not programmed to have a short life, but to respect the environment and that do not generate waste that sometimes end up discharging in garbage containers in the third world. The lamp created by OEP Electrics responds to the current need of a commitment to the environment. At last a long time, does not generate waste while allowing energy savings up to 92% and gives up to 70% less CO2. But, it seems, the industry of electrical products is not very happy with the discovery. Benito says Walls is being threatened due to his invention and even claims to have been offered millions to withdraw its product from the market. - "Mr. Walls, you can not put your lighting systems on the market. You and your family will be wiped out, "reads the complaint Walls presented to the Police, who despite fear not flinch. To perform your search, Walls traveled to the fire station to Livermore (California), a place in which there is a lamp that stays on continuously for over 111 years. Ali contacted and known descendants of the creators of the lamp, because there was no documentation about it. With this information got the bases to start your research, whose finding implies a new concept of business model based on non Obsolescence Program.
